For anyone who is interested in a decent editor for hand coding html I
personally use EditPad Pro from http://www.editpadpro.com/=20

It costs $39.95 (or EditPad Lite is free), and includes syntax
highlighting, multiple documents, line numbering/auto indent
(configurable by file type) and loads of other features (including view
this file in a web browser)

I recommend it anyway.

There's vim aswell which is completely free but I'm used to EditPad.
